#5497CF Hex Color Code

#5497CF

The Hexadecimal Color #5497CF is a contrast shade of Corn Flower Blue. #5497CF RGB value is rgb(84, 151, 207). RGB Color Model of #5497CF consists of 32% red, 59% green and 81% blue. HSL color Mode of #5497CF has 207°(degrees) Hue, 56% Saturation and 57% Lightness. #5497CF color has an wavelength of 489.66667n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#5497CF is #6699FF.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#5497CF is #59C. The Closest Color to #5497CF is #6495ED. Official Name of #5497CF Hex Code is Havelock Blue.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#5497CF is 59 Cyan 27 Magenta 0 Yellow 19 Black and #5497CF CMY is 59, 27, 0.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#5497CF is hsl(207,56,57,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(207, 59, 81).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#5497CF is 25.98, 28.52, 63.16.
Hex8 Value of #5497CF is #5497CFFF. Decimal Value of #5497CF is 5543887 and Octal Value of #5497CF is 25113717. Binary Value of #5497CF is 1010100, 10010111, 11001111 and Android of #5497CF is 4283733967 / 0xff5497cf.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#5497CF is 0.221, 0.242, 0.242 and YIQ Color Space of #5497CF is 137.351, -57.9181, 3.2567.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#5497CF is 21.03, 30.52, 62.58.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#5497CF is 60.36, -4.63, -35.15.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#5497CF is 60.36, -28.47, -54.39.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#5497CF is 60.36, 35.45, 262.5. Hunter Lab variable of #5497CF is 53.4, -6.62, -32.74.

Various Color Shades of #5497CF

To get 25% Saturated #5497CF Color, you need to convert the hex color #5497CF to the HSL (Hue, Saturation, Lightness) color space, increase the saturation value by 25%, and then convert it back to the hex color. To desaturate a color by 25%, we need to reduce its saturation level while keeping the same hue and lightness. Saturation represents the intensity or vividness of a color. A 100% saturation means the color is fully vivid, while a 0% saturation results in a shade of gray. To make a color 25% darker or 25% lighter, you need to reduce the intensity of each of its RGB (Red, Green, Blue) components by 25% or increase it to 25%. Inverting a #5497CF hex color involves converting each of its RGB (Red, Green, Blue) components to their complementary values. The complementary color is found by subtracting each component's value from the maximum value of 255.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#5497CF

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
